ZF

ZF Gainesville, LLC, located in Gainesville, Ga. started operations three decades ago with approximately 80 employees in its first year. Today, the headcount is nearly 600 at three plants. The facility utilizes corporate and global standard lean principles, under the name “ZF Production Systems” (ZFPS), to ensure consistency in safety, quality and productivity despite a diverse product & process portfolio. Employees are encouraged to achieve level certifications in the ZFPS principles which re-enforces a culture of lean at all levels.

At Plant I, you’ll see the production of axle drives for the automotive industry. At Plant II, you’ll see the production of axles systems and steering and suspension components for the commercial vehicle truck and bus industry, gearboxes for light and heavy rail, and axles, transmissions and final drives for construction machinery. At Plant III, you’ll see the production of clutches for commercial vehicle trucks. 

About ZF

ZF is a global leader in driveline and chassis technology as well as active and passive safety technology. The company has a global workforce of 146,000 with approximately 230 locations in 40 countries. In 2017, ZF achieved sales of €36.4 billion. Learn more at www.zf.com.
